San Carlos (Equatorial Guinea)

San Carlos (also Gran Caldera de Luba, or simply Caldera) is a basaltic shield volcano with a broad summit caldera on the island of Bioko, Equatorial Guinea.[3] With an elevation of 2,261 metres above sea level it is the second highest peak in Equatorial Guinea.
